I connected the speaker and input connections to the board with 20 AWG wire. I then connected the 3.7v 18650 lithium battery and case. Plugged in speakers and laptop output. Turned it on and everything worked. I cut the wires to the battery compartment and added a 2.1x5.5 male and female connector. I turned on the amp and all I heard was a continuous click. I removed the plug and connector, reconnected the wires. Same, click when it's on. That's the amp, not my connections. Today I connected the 2nd amp using 2.3 and 4 pin JSP headers soldered to the board and used 2.3 and 4 pin sockets for input, output and power connections (lithium battery 3 .7V). Nothing really happened. I will return them for a refund.
